About Matthew Schomer
Matthew is a journalist in the news department at TheBestWarGames. He holds a Bachelor's degree in journalism from Kent State University and has been an avid gamer since 1985. Matthew formerly served as a news and features editor, trainer, and video producer at DualShockers, specializing in shortform video guides.
Prior to entering the world of electronic entertainment, he was a reporter for multiple rural Ohio newspapers, most notably The Salem News and the Morning Journal (Lisbon), specializing in state and local politics, law, education, and human interest.
When not scouring the internet for the juciest gaming tidbits or grinding away at his favorite RPGs, Matthew enjoys acting and singing. He is wrapping up production on his first audio novel and makes frequent appearances in online readings of the musical Off the Beaten Path and its related Stories of Arlyrus and Chronicles of D'ar plays, as well as serving as a regular contributor to its newsletter, The Karsis Khryer.
